WebChain Of Hearts can grow fast in the right position, so snip pieces off and share with your friends and family. They are easy to propagate by placing the cutting into some water, it will then develop new roots within a month or so for replanting and gifting. WebCommon Name: String of Hearts plant, Rosary Vine, Chain of Hearts, Sweetheart Vine, Hearts enmeshed. Origin: South Africa, Swaziland and Zimbabwe.
